يونڪس ۾ Ulimit حڪم جو ڪم ڇا آهي؟

هي حڪم سسٽم وسيلن تي حدون مقرر ڪري ٿو يا سسٽم وسيلن تي حدن بابت معلومات ڏيکاري ٿو جيڪي مقرر ڪيا ويا آهن. هي حڪم سسٽم وسيلن تي مٿئين حدن کي مقرر ڪرڻ لاء استعمال ڪيو ويو آهي جيڪي اختيار جي وضاحتن سان بيان ڪيا ويا آهن، انهي سان گڏ معياري ٻاھرين حدن کي ٻاھر ڪڍڻ لاء جيڪي مقرر ڪيا ويا آھن.

يونڪس ۾ Ulimit حڪم ڇا آهي؟

ulimit حڪم صارف جي عمل جي وسيلن جي حدن کي سيٽ يا رپورٽ ڪري ٿو. ڊفالٽ حدون بيان ڪيون وينديون آهن ۽ لاڳو ٿينديون آهن جڏهن هڪ نئون صارف سسٽم ۾ شامل ڪيو ويندو آهي. ... ulimit ڪمانڊ سان، توھان تبديل ڪري سگھوٿا پنھنجي نرم حدن کي موجوده شيل ماحول لاءِ، وڌ ۾ وڌ مقرر ڪيل سخت حدن تائين.

مان لينڪس ۾ Ulimit ڪيئن استعمال ڪري سگهان ٿو؟

ulimit حڪم:

  1. ulimit -n -> اهو ڏيکاريندو کليل فائلن جي تعداد جي حد.
  2. ulimit -c -> اهو بنيادي فائل جي سائيز کي ڏيکاري ٿو.
  3. umilit -u -> اهو ڏيکاريندو وڌ ۾ وڌ استعمال ڪندڙ عمل جي حد لاگ ان ٿيل استعمال ڪندڙ لاءِ.
  4. ulimit -f -> اهو وڌ ۾ وڌ فائل سائيز ڏيکاريندو جيڪو صارف ڪري سگھي ٿو.

9. 2019.

آئون Ulimit قدر ڪيئن مقرر ڪري سگهان ٿو؟

لينڪس تي ulimit قدرن کي سيٽ ڪرڻ يا تصديق ڪرڻ لاءِ:

  1. روٽ استعمال ڪندڙ طور لاگ ان ڪريو.
  2. /etc/security/limits.conf فائل کي ايڊٽ ڪريو ۽ ھيٺيون قدر بيان ڪريو: admin_user_ID نرم nofile 32768. admin_user_ID هارڊ nofile 65536. …
  3. admin_user_ID طور لاگ ان ٿيو.
  4. سسٽم کي ٻيهر شروع ڪريو: esadmin سسٽم اسٽاپ. esadmin سسٽم جي شروعات.

لينڪس ۾ Ulimit ڪٿي قائم آهي؟

  1. ulimit سيٽنگ کي تبديل ڪرڻ لاء، فائل کي تبديل ڪريو /etc/security/limits.conf ۽ ان ۾ سخت ۽ نرم حدون مقرر ڪريو: ...
  2. ھاڻي، ھيٺ ڏنل حڪمن کي استعمال ڪندي سسٽم سيٽنگون ٽيسٽ ڪريو: ...
  3. موجوده کليل فائل بيان ڪندڙ جي حد چيڪ ڪرڻ لاء: ...
  4. اهو معلوم ڪرڻ لاءِ ته هن وقت ڪيترا فائل بيان ڪندڙ استعمال ڪيا پيا وڃن:

Ulimit ڇا آهي؟

ulimit منتظم جي رسائي جي ضرورت آهي لينڪس شيل ڪمانڊ جيڪا موجوده استعمال ڪندڙ جي وسيلن جي استعمال کي ڏسڻ، سيٽ ڪرڻ، يا محدود ڪرڻ لاء استعمال ڪيو ويندو آهي. اهو هر عمل لاء کليل فائل بيان ڪندڙن جو تعداد واپس ڪرڻ لاء استعمال ڪيو ويندو آهي. اهو پڻ استعمال ڪيو ويندو آهي پابنديون مقرر ڪرڻ لاءِ استعمال ڪيل وسيلن تي عمل جي ذريعي.

ڇا Ulimit هڪ عمل آهي؟

ulimit هڪ حد آهي في پروسيس نه سيشن يا صارف پر توهان محدود ڪري سگهو ٿا ڪيترا پروسيس استعمال ڪندڙ هلائي سگهن ٿا.

Ulimit لامحدود لينڪس ڪيئن ٺاهيو؟

پڪ ڪريو ته جڏهن توهان ٽائپ ڪريو روٽ طور ڪمانڊ ulimit -a توهان جي ٽرمينل تي، اهو ڏيکاري ٿو لامحدود اڳيان وڌ کان وڌ استعمال ڪندڙ عملن جي. : توھان پڻ ڪري سگھو ٿا ulimit -u لامحدود ڪمانڊ پرامٽ تي ان کي شامل ڪرڻ بدران /root/ ۾. bashrc فائل. توھان کي لازمي طور تي پنھنجي ٽرمينل مان نڪرڻو پوندو ۽ تبديلي کي اثر انداز ڪرڻ لاءِ ٻيهر لاگ ان ٿيڻو پوندو.

مان لينڪس ۾ کليل حدون ڪيئن ڏسان؟

لينڪس ۾ کليل فائلن جو تعداد محدود ڇو آهي؟

  1. ڳوليو کليل فائلن جي حد في پروسيس: ulimit -n.
  2. سڀني کوليل فائلن کي ڳڻيو سڀني عملن سان: lsof | wc -l.
  3. کليل فائلن جي وڌ ۾ وڌ اجازت ڏنل نمبر حاصل ڪريو: cat /proc/sys/fs/file-max.

لينڪس ۾ فائل بيان ڪندڙ ڇا آهن؟

يونڪس ۽ لاڳاپيل ڪمپيوٽر آپريٽنگ سسٽم ۾، هڪ فائل ڊسپيڪٽر (FD، گهٽ بار بار فائلز) هڪ خلاصو اشارو (هينڊل) آهي جيڪو ڪنهن فائل يا ٻئي ان پٽ/آئوٽ پٽ ريسورس تائين رسائي لاءِ استعمال ڪيو ويندو آهي، جهڙوڪ پائپ يا نيٽ ورڪ ساڪٽ.

مان ڪيئن مستقل طور Ulimit مقرر ڪري سگهان ٿو؟

تبديل ڪريو ulimit قدر مستقل طور تي

  1. ڊومين: صارفين جا نالا، گروپ، GUID حدون، وغيره.
  2. قسم: حد جو قسم (نرم/سخت)
  3. شيءِ: اهو وسيلو جيڪو محدود ٿيڻ وارو آهي، مثال طور، بنيادي سائيز، nproc، فائيل سائيز، وغيره.
  4. قدر: حد قدر.

ميڪس بند ٿيل ياداشت ڇا آهي؟

وڌ ۾ وڌ بند ٿيل ميموري (kbytes، -l) وڌ ۾ وڌ سائيز جيڪا ميموري ۾ بند ٿي سگھي ٿي. ميموري لاڪنگ يقيني بڻائي ٿي ته ميموري هميشه رام ۾ آهي ۽ ڪڏهن به ادل ڊسڪ ڏانهن منتقل نه ٿيندي آهي.

What is a soft limit?

The soft limit is the value of the current process limit that is enforced by the operating system. … New processes receive the same limits as the parent process as long as the installation or the application do not alter those values and an identity change does not occur.

لينڪس ۾ اوپن فائلون ڇا آهي؟

Lsof هڪ فائيل سسٽم تي استعمال ڪيو ويندو آهي سڃاڻپ ڪرڻ لاء جيڪو ڪنهن فائلن کي استعمال ڪري رهيو آهي انهي فائل سسٽم تي. توھان لينڪس فائل سسٽم تي lsof ڪمانڊ هلائي سگھو ٿا ۽ آئوٽ مالڪ کي سڃاڻي ٿو ۽ فائل کي استعمال ڪندي پروسيس لاءِ معلومات کي پروسيس ڪري ٿو جيئن ھيٺ ڏنل آئوٽ ۾ ڏيکاريل آھي. $lsof /dev/null. لينڪس ۾ سڀني کوليل فائلن جي فهرست.

مان لينڪس ۾ کليل حد ڪيئن وڌائي سگهان ٿو؟

توھان وڌائي سگھوٿا لينڪس ۾ کوليل فائلن جي حد کي ايڊٽ ڪندي ڪرينل ڊائريڪٽو fs. فائيل-max. انهي مقصد لاء، توهان استعمال ڪري سگهو ٿا sysctl افاديت. Sysctl رن ٽائم تي ڪنييل پيٽرولر کي ترتيب ڏيڻ لاء استعمال ڪيو ويندو آهي.

مان لينڪس ۾ کليل فائلن کي ڪيئن بند ڪري سگهان ٿو؟

جيڪڏھن توھان چاھيو ٿا صرف کليل فائل بيان ڪندڙن کي بند ڪريو، توھان استعمال ڪري سگھوٿا proc فائل سسٽم سسٽم تي جتي اھو موجود آھي. مثال طور لينڪس تي، /proc/self/fd سڀني کليل فائل بيان ڪندڙن کي لسٽ ڪندو. انهي ڊاريڪٽري تي ٻيهر ورجايو، ۽ سڀڪنھن شيء کي بند ڪريو > 2، فائل بيان ڪندڙ کان سواء جيڪو ڊاريڪٽري کي بيان ڪري ٿو جيڪو توھان ٻيهر ورجائي رھيا آھيو.

ڇا هن پوسٽ وانگر؟ مهرباني ڪري پنهنجن دوستن کي شيئر ڪريو:
OS اڄ